Product Detailed Parameters

  • Description:IC PWR SWITCH P-CHAN 1:1 6TDFN
  • Series:-
  • Mfr:Microchip Technology
  • Package:Tape & Reel (TR),Cut Tape (CT)
  • Switch Type:General Purpose
  • Number of Outputs:1
  • Ratio - Input:Output:1:01
  • Output Configuration:High Side
  • Output Type:P-Channel
  • Interface:On/Off
  • Voltage - Load:2.5V ~ 5.5V
  • Voltage - Supply (Vcc/Vdd):Not Required
  • Current - Output (Max):550mA
  • Rds On (Typ):75mOhm
  • Input Type:Non-Inverting
  • Features:Slew Rate Controlled, Status Flag
  • Fault Protection:Current Limiting (Fixed), Over Temperature, UVLO
  • Operating Temperature:-40°C ~ 125°C (TJ)
  • Mounting Type:Surface Mount
  • Supplier Device Package:6-TDFN (2x2)
  • Package / Case:6-UDFN Exposed Pad

Overview

The MIC2033-55AYMT-TR is a high-side power distribution switch manufactured by Microchip Technology. It features a fixed current limit of 550mA with 5% accuracy, ensuring precise load protection. The device operates within a supply voltage range of 2.5V to 5.5V and exhibits a typical on-resistance of 75mΩ. Packaged in a compact 6-TDFN (2x2mm) format with an exposed pad, it supports non-inverting input control. Key electrical characteristics include a maximum turn-on time of 700µs and a maximum idle time of 5µs, suitable for efficient power management applications.

Feature Summary

  • High-accuracy 5% fixed current limit for reliable load protection
  • Integrated status flag output for fault indication
  • Slew rate controlled turn-on to minimize inrush current
  • Compact TDFN package with exposed thermal pad

Selection Notes

Select this component when precise current limiting with 5% accuracy is required for high-side switching applications. The 550mA rating suits moderate load currents where low on-resistance reduces power dissipation. Consider the non-inverting logic interface for direct microcontroller control. The exposed pad design necessitates adequate PCB copper area for thermal relief during operation.

Part Context

This device belongs to the MIC2033 series of high-side power switches designed for robust system reliability. The series utilizes advanced MOSFET technology to provide fast response times and accurate current limiting. The -55A suffix typically denotes the specific 550mA current limit variant within the product line, distinguishing it from other current ratings available in the same package family.
